description Revascularization of coronary arteries is a key method of the contemporary treatment of patients with atherosclerotic coronary stenoses. However, at an intermediate degree of stenosis, the decision on the appropriateness of revascularization may depend on additional studies of the functional significance of anatomical changes. The study of the fractional flow reserve (FFR) may have a special role in such cases. The publication considers an example of determining the extent of endovascular revascularization in a patient with multivessel lesions of the coronary arteries, with intermediate severity of stenosis. The combination of functional class II angina with unclear result of a stress test, as well as the lack of optimal drug therapy at the time of examination led to the decision to assess physiological significance of all existing stenoses by determining the FFR. Based on the FFR, it was decided to continue monitoring the patient, prescribe optimal medical therapy and refrain from revascularization intervention until the evaluation of its results
